
Panasonic FK Series polar capacitor, 220µF, 50V DC. Offers a 670mA ripple current and operates from -55°C to 105°C. Ideal for circuit filtering.
The Panasonic FK Series Polar Capacitor offers reliable performance for a variety of electronic applications. With a capacitance of 220µF and a direct current voltage rating of 50V, this component is designed to deliver stable and efficient energy storage, smoothing, and filtering in electrical circuits.
Engineered for demanding durability, the capacitor operates effectively within a broad temperature range, from as low as -55°C up to a maximum of 105°C. It features a capacitance tolerance of ±20% and can comfortably handle a ripple current of up to 670mA, making it highly suitable for environments where consistent power delivery and voltage regulation are essential.
